Victoria’s Vulnerability Exposed to Ice Warriors
Plot Beats
The narrative micro-steps within this event
Victoria, held captive by the Ice Warriors in their excavated cave, expresses her uncertainty, initiating the tension within the scene as her potential betrayal becomes a concern for the Ice Warriors.

Location Details
Places and their significance in this event
The glacier cave serves as a claustrophobic prison, its thick ice walls trapping Victoria in a space that amplifies her isolation and fear. The cold, oppressive atmosphere mirrors the emotional weight of the moment, where Victoria’s whispered admission feels swallowed by the vast, indifferent silence of the glacier. The cave’s static-filled interference not only blocks radio signals but also symbolizes the breakdown in communication—both between Victoria and her captors, and between Victoria and her own resolve.
